- 首页 >
- 问答 >
-
智能运维 >
- Debian Postman的日志文件如何查看
Debian Postman的日志文件如何查看
小樊
44
2025-11-19 03:21:17
Debian 上 Postman 日志查看指南
一 桌面版 Postman 的日志查看
- 在应用内查看请求与脚本输出:打开 Postman,点击底部或菜单中的控制台 Console,可查看每个请求的请求/响应头与正文、网络信息以及你在测试脚本中使用 console.log/info/warn/error 输出的内容;可按日志类型过滤,并可开关时间戳与网络信息。快捷键示例:Option+Ctrl+C(macOS)/ Ctrl+Alt+C(Windows/Linux)。
- 导出应用日志用于留存或上报:在 Postman 左上角进入文件 File → 首选项 Preferences → 常规 General → 数据 Data → 浏览 Browse,打开数据目录;其中的 Logs/ 目录包含运行日志,按需复制或打包分享。
二 命令行 Newman 的日志查看与输出到文件
- 直接查看运行输出:在终端执行 Newman 命令时,将标准输出与错误输出重定向到文件,例如:
- 基本保存:newman run collection.json -r cli,json --reporter-json-export report.json > newman.log 2>&1
- 仅保存错误:newman run collection.json 2> newman-error.log
- 使用内置 JSON/CSV/TTY 报告器导出结构化日志,便于后续分析或导入报表工具。
- 若以 systemd 服务方式运行 Newman,可用 journalctl 查看服务日志:
- 查看服务日志:journalctl -u newman.service -b --no-pager
- 实时跟踪:journalctl -u newman.service -f
- 说明:Postman 桌面应用本身不提供持久化“文件日志”的配置项;如需文件日志,请使用 Newman 或将输出重定向到文件。
三 系统级日志与定位线索
- 当 Postman/Newman 以系统服务、容器或代理方式运行时,可在 /var/log/ 或通过 journalctl 检索相关输出:
- 检索系统日志:grep -i postman /var/log/syslog 或使用 less 分页查看
- 按服务查看:journalctl -u postman.service -b(将服务名替换为你的实际单元名,如 newman.service)
- 若你实际要排查的是邮件服务(常见误写为 Postman 的 Postfix),应查看邮件日志:
- 实时查看:sudo tail -f /var/log/mail.log
- 服务日志:journalctl -u postfix
四 常见问题与快速命令清单
- 快速命令清单
- 应用内控制台:底部/菜单打开Console,用 console.log 输出调试信息
- 导出应用日志:File → Preferences → General → Data → Browse → Logs/
- Newman 保存日志:newman run coll.json -r cli,json > run.log 2>&1
- Newman JSON 报告:newman run coll.json -r json --reporter-json-export report.json
- 实时查看服务日志:journalctl -u your-service.service -f
- 系统日志检索:grep -i postman /var/log/syslog
- 易混服务提示:邮件相关请查 /var/log/mail.log 与 journalctl -u postfix,不要与 Postman 混淆。